Car Sharing in Greece

Car sharing has become increasingly popular in Greece as it provides a sustainable and convenient transportation option for people who do not own a car or need an additional vehicle for a short period of time. Car sharing allows people to rent a car for a few hours or days and return it to a designated location, instead of owning a car and dealing with the costs and responsibilities that come with it. In this article, we will explore the car sharing options available in Greece, including the companies, apps, and prices, as well as the benefits and challenges of car sharing.

Car Sharing Companies in Greece

There are several car sharing companies operating in Greece, including CarAmigo, DriveNow, and Zipcar. Each company has its own unique features, prices, and areas of coverage. Let’s take a closer look at these companies:

CarAmigo

CarAmigo is a peer-to-peer car sharing platform that connects car owners with people who need a car. CarAmigo offers a wide range of cars, from small city cars to luxury cars, at affordable prices. The platform is available in Athens, Thessaloniki, and other major cities in Greece. CarAmigo is a good option for people who need a car for a short period of time and want to avoid the high costs of traditional car rental companies.

CarAmigo offers competitive prices, with rates starting at €18 per day for a small city car and going up to €150 per day for a luxury car. The price includes insurance, roadside assistance, and 24/7 customer support. CarAmigo also offers a flexible pricing system, allowing users to negotiate prices with car owners. This can be a great option for people who are looking for a budget-friendly car rental.

DriveNow

DriveNow is a car sharing service that operates in Athens and offers a fleet of BMW and MINI cars. Users can register for the service through the DriveNow app and rent a car for as little as 30 minutes. DriveNow is a good option for people who want to drive a high-quality car and enjoy a premium car sharing experience.

DriveNow offers a flexible pricing system that allows users to pay for the exact time they use the car. The rates start at €0.31 per minute for a BMW 1 Series and can go up to €0.34 per minute for a BMW i3 electric car. The price includes insurance, fuel, and parking fees. DriveNow also offers a variety of car models, from small city cars to larger SUVs, to suit different needs.

Zipcar

Zipcar is a car sharing service that operates in Athens and offers a fleet of cars, including sedans, SUVs, and hybrids. Zipcar users can reserve a car through the app and pick it up from a designated location. The Zipcar is a good option for people who want to rent a car for a few hours or days and avoid the hassle of traditional car rental companies.

They offers a pay-as-you-go pricing system, which allows users to pay for the exact time they use the car. The rates start at €4 per hour for a small city car and can go up to €66 per day for a premium car. The price includes insurance, fuel, and 24/7 roadside assistance. Zipcar also offers a variety of car models to suit different needs.

Other Car Sharing Companies

Apart from CarAmigo, DriveNow, and Zipcar, there are other car sharing companies operating in Greece, such as GoCar and Ubeeqo. GoCar offers a fleet of electric cars in Athens, while Ubeeqo offers a variety of car models in Athens and Thessaloniki. It’s worth doing research to find the car sharing company that best suits your needs and location.

Car Sharing Prices in Greece

Car sharing prices in Greece vary depending on the company, the car type, and the duration of the rental. Here are some price examples:

  • CarAmigo: Prices start at €18 per day for a small city car and can go up to €150 per day for a luxury car.
  • DriveNow: Rates start at €0.31 per minute for a BMW 1 Series and can go up to €0.34 per minute for a BMW i3 electric car.
  • Zipcar: Rates start at €4 per hour for a small city car and can go up to €66 per day for a premium car.

It’s worth noting that car sharing companies may also require a membership fee or a deposit, depending on the company and the rental terms.

Challenges of Car Sharing

While car sharing offers several benefits, there are also some challenges that need to be addressed. These challenges include the following:

Limited Coverage

Car sharing companies may not have coverage in all areas, which can limit the availability of cars and the convenience of the service. Users may need to travel to a designated location to pick up and return the car, which can be inconvenient for some.

Vehicle Availability

Car sharing companies may not have enough cars available during peak times, such as weekends or holidays. This can make it difficult for users to reserve a car when they need it.

User Responsibility

Car sharing requires users to take responsibility for the car and follow the rental terms, such as returning the car on time and in good condition. Users may also need to clean the car and refuel it before returning it, which can be inconvenient for some.
